TBB 776S is a 1978 Triumph T140V in Black with a 744c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 95.2%.
Across all 1978 Triumph T140V models, the average MOT pass rate is 89.0% with a typical mileage of 18,337 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Triumph T140V fails its MOT is shock absorber seal failed and leaking oil, accounting for 16 recorded failures. If you're considering buying TBB 776S,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Triumph T140V typically stays on UK roads for around 53 years. At 48 years old, this Triumph T140V is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
